To participate in Online Gambling, the gambler must register and set up a user account with an online casino. The registration process usually involves inputting personal information and creating a user name and password. The gambler then funds his or her online gambling account with a credit card, bank transfer or other method and begins to play. When winnings are generated, they are either deposited in the gambler’s online account or sent to him or her via a check.
